Antique necklace of the Biedermeier period, made of yellow gold 585 / 14 Kt (tested and guaranteed). The pendant, made of rocailles, leaves and rollers, has a reddish-brown carnelian in oval cabochon cut in its centre. The richly decorated cartouche is complemented by a suspension at the end of which an ornamental decorative element is attached that merges into a finely shimmering natural pearl. The chain of the piece of jewellery must be closed at the back with a spring ring which functions safely.
The historical necklace was created around 1850 in Germany and is an authentic jewel of the Biedermeier period. Today it can be combined perfectly with traditional costume and Dirndl, but also fits very well with the classic style.
Length of the chain: 43 cm.
Dimensions of the trailer (incl. suspension): 3.0 x 5.4 cm.
Dimensions of the carnelian: approx. 9.9 x 6.7 mm.
Diameter of the natural pearl: approx. 4.9 mm.
Weight: 8.6 grams.
Condition: Very nice condition, freshly cleaned, see photos.
